Moses Itauma faces Jermaine Franklin Jr. in Manchester this Saturday, viewing the bout as the "final piece of the puzzle" before pursuing a world title. Itauma, boasting a record of 13-0 with 11 KOs, seeks valuable ring experience against the seasoned Franklin, who holds a 24-2 record. Franklin's only losses were decisions against Anthony Joshua and Dillian Whyte. Itauma hasn't gone past Round 2 in his last nine outings, raising questions about his endurance and ability to handle pressure. Promoter Frank Warren emphasizes the significance of this fight, noting Franklin’s wealth of experience. Itauma states, "I have a serious opponent in Jermaine Franklin," acknowledging the need to prove himself to fans and critics alike. The 21-year-old heavyweight aims to showcase his skills beyond early knockouts. This showdown could define Itauma's path to heavyweight greatness.
